Don't get me wrong I'd never claim a bike and I don't like the idea of it, but there must be easier ways to cap spending (regulated specifications / a list of permissable modifications like almost all other forms of motor racing)?
Lastly, if they are gonna keep this claiming rule, surely they need to update the price? You could probably lose an otherwise stock Austrian bike with just a pipe, a KYB conversion and some plastics nowadays and still be out of pocket at 200%, let alone 130% elsewhere.

So, I would assume a claim mid race or between classes would be handled in the same manner. The rules state a claim can be entered anytime during the meet up to 30 minutes after the race results.
Edit: For the question on multiple bikes. When you enter you must list the VIN for each bike and class. You must ride the same bike entered in each class for the complete meet. If you get caught swapping bikes you would be DQ'd.
I suppose they could do an engine swap, but the one they took out must remain in impound?
